Effects of MAC protocols on the performance of wireless network coding
Network coding provides a powerful mechanism for improving performance of wireless networks. In this paper, we study the effects of MAC protocols on the performance of wireless network coding. To model the MAC protocols, we introduce the dummy topology graph (DTG) of a wireless network that can properly describe the broadcast property of wireless channels. Based on the DTG, we derive theoretical formulations for computing the end-to-end delay of flows using the theory of network calculus. Numerical results show that the fairness of the MAC protocols can help to improve the performance of wireless network coding.
